Mango pulp is obtained by washing, peeling, and puréeing ripe mangoes, followed by heating to inactivate enzymes and concentrating the juice into a thick, homogenous product. The commodity is freely exportable from India without a license. It is used primarily as an ingredient in beverages, confectionery, and processed food applications.
